CORE is a unique take on property damage restoration. Made up of the largest and most capable property restoration service providers, CORE is redefining what it means to restore lives. CORE's business model is unlike anything else on the market today and offers elite contractors the ability to be a part of a premier service offering, align themselves with an organization that believes in operating with the highest standards of craftsmanship, quality and integrity, all without giving up their independence.The total investment necessary to begin operation of a single CORE Group Restoration franchised business is between $76,000 and $371,150. This includes $50,000 to $93,150 that must be paid to the franchisor or its affiliate(s). The total investment necessary to begin operation of two CORE Businesses under a Multi-Unit Franchise is between $127,000 and $742,300. This includes $75,000 to $186,300 that must be paid to the franchisor or its affiliate(s). The total investment necessary to begin operation of ten CORE Businesses under a Multi-Unit Franchise is between $335,000 and $3,111,500. This includes $150,000 to $331,500 that must be paid to the franchisor or its affiliate(s).

How much does it cost to open a CORE Group Restoration Franchise ?

The investment required to open a CORE Group Restoration Franchise is between $76,000 - $371,150 . There is an initial franchise fee of $30,000 which grants you the license to run a business under the CORE Group Restoration name.
